M’sia-China event presents potential business linkups


(From left) Low, Li, Teo, Zheng and Abdul Majid launching CSITE 2025. — ONG SOON HIN/The Star

China Entrepreneurs Association in Malaysia (PUCM) continues to foster strong Malaysia-China relations by promoting economic growth and cross-cultural exchange between the nations.

PUCM president Datuk Keith Li said one of the association’s achievements was the China Smart Industry Trade Exhibition (CSITE) promoting business links between Malaysia and China.
